Publisher's Synopsis

This expanded and updated second edition contains fully captioned colour slides illustrating hypertension diagnosis using MRI, CT and Doppler imaging, as well as angiograms and histology.;The slides show the effects of hypertension on the brain, eye, heart and kidneys, and in diabetes mellitus. They also illustrate the very latest methods of blood pressure measurement using ambulatory recordings, digital subtraction angiography, MRI and three-dimensional spiral CT angiography. In addition, the slides include cases of renovascular and renal hypertension, primary aldosteronism along with other forms of mineralocorticoid hypertension and Cushing's syndrome, and pheochromocytoma. A section on miscellaneous conditions shows cases of hyperparathyroidism, acromegaly, gestational hypertension involving oestrogens, contraceptives and hormone replacement therapy, coarctation of the aorta, and other risk factors.
